Abstract
In video coding, the coding decisions made during the encoding of a reference frame impact the achievable rate distortion performance of all inter-predicted frames which refer to it. Most encoders operate frame-by-frame and do not specifically consider this inter-dependency. In this paper, a multi-frame transform coefficient optimization method for H.265/HEVC is proposed. The inter-frame dependencies are described using a linear signal model, such that the optimization problem can be cast in the form of an ℓ1-regularized least squares problem. A simple functional relationship between the regularization parameter and the quantization paramter is empirically found. Bit rate savings are in the range of 7-10% for a simple IPPP... prediction structure and about 3% for a random access configuration.
